Geographical Location
Popowe Wierchy, Banne and Rotunda are located in the immediate vicinity of Gładyszów.
Dziamera lies in the surrounding area of Gładyszów.
Gładyszów is located in the central Beskid Niski, southeast of Magura Małastowska; the settlement stretches along the valley of the Gładyszówka stream.
Culture
Gładyszów has three wooden Orthodox churches and war cemeteries from the First World War.
Gładyszów is also connected with the wooden architecture trail, which runs through Gładyszów, Zdynia and Konieczna.
History
Written references to Gładyszów date from 1629; the settlement is estimated to have been founded in the late 16th century.
Nature
According to local tourism information, Gładyszów is described as a hilly, forested landscape with beech and fir forests, clear streams, and meadows with frequently protected vegetation.
Hiking in the surrounding landscape is associated with sightings of deer, roe deer, beavers, foxes, wolves and several bird species. For travelers interested in nature and wildlife observation, this is a specific facet of the destination.
Bus connections link Gładyszów with Gorlice and Konieczna.
Nearby regional points of interest include Wysowa-Zdrój, Uście Gorlickie and Lake Klimkówka.
